Ryde's distinct blend of Federation‑era homes, mid‑century brick homes and modern-day apartment or condos suggests that a seasoned Ryde electrician need to be comfortable repairing the quirks of decades‑old wiring as well as installing the sophisticated electrical systems seen in freshly constructed tasks. Much of the residential area's older houses pose problems such as worn‑out website insulation, antiquated ceramic fuse panels that provide little protection versus overloads or earth faults, and the absence of security turns on power and lighting circuits required by New South Wales policies. Repairing these imperfections isn't merely a cosmetic upgrade-- it's important for removing the real dangers that dated electrical installations present to homeowners every day. A licensed Ryde electrician will carry out an extensive inspection, present the results in a clear and truthful way, and describe a detailed method to update the property's electrical facilities to meet AS/NZS 3000 requirements and guarantee the security of everybody inside.

Compliance and licensing form the bedrock of trustworthy electrical operate in New South Wales, and every credible electrician in Ryde runs within this structure without exception. NSW Fair Trading is the body responsible for issuing and overseeing electrical licences in the state, and verifying that your selected electrician holds an existing and legitimate licence before work starts is a step no property owner need to avoid. Upon completing any electrical installation or repair work, a certified electrician in Ryde is lawfully required to provide a Certificate of Compliance for Electrical Work, which serves as official paperwork that the work has been performed to the standard required by law. This certificate is not simply paperwork-- it is an essential record that supports insurance claims, satisfies requirements during property deals, and provides proof of compliance must any concerns develop in the future. Recognizing the right electrician in Ryde for your particular needs does not need to be a frustrating process if you know what to look for. Start by inspecting the NSW Fair Trading licence register to verify that any tradesperson you are considering is effectively authorised to carry out electrical operate in Australia. From there, search for consistent favorable reviews from local Ryde customers, ask good friends or neighbours for personal recommendations, and request written quotes that clearly itemise labour, materials, and any suitable call-out charges. The most trusted electricians in Ryde are those who respond quickly to queries, get here on time, describe the scope of operate in plain language, and support their completed tasks with a clear workmanship service warranty.
